3. Maximillian

Played by Eddie Murphy From Vampire in Brooklyn (1995) Is
Vampire in BrooklynEddie Murphys worst moment? Hell no, not by a long way, it still stinks like a day old cup of vomit though. As Ive already mentioned,
Vampire in Brooklyn was directed by
Wes Craven, hard to believe I know. It seems a coincidence that Craven went on to make the genre redefining
Scream directly after his work on this critically panned comedy-horror from the pen of Mr. Murphy Boy did he wash that stink off in style. Murphy, looking more Lando Calrissian than vampire, is Maximillian a debonair Caribbean vampire who travels to New York to find himself the half-vampire daughter of a fellow bloodsucker, played by
Angela Bassett. While Murphys star was already on the decline by the time
Vampire in Brooklyn hit screens, that didnt stop him taking on his trademark multiple roles, playing in addition to Maximillian, a profane preacher and an Italian gangster
Peter Sellers he is not. A film that had the potential to be something quite different and interesting ended up being nothing more than the standard dick-joke fare that became indicative of most of Murphys work in the 90s and I would imagine is a film that
Wes Craven has probably stricken from his memory.
